Financial Benefits
One of the most compelling reasons to install solar panels is the potential for significant financial savings. By generating your own electricity, you can drastically reduce or even eliminate your monthly utility bills. In some regions, excess energy produced by solar panels can be sold back to the grid, creating a passive income stream. Additionally, many governments offer tax incentives, rebates, or grants for solar installations, helping offset the initial investment. Over time, these financial advantages make solar panels not just an eco-friendly choice but a smart economic decision.
Environmental Impact
Beyond financial savings, solar panels contribute to a cleaner and healthier environment. Solar energy is renewable and produces zero greenhouse gas emissions during operation. By reducing reliance on fossil fuels, homeowners who adopt solar power actively decrease their carbon footprint, helping combat climate change and air pollution. Switching to solar also promotes energy independence, reducing strain on local power grids and supporting sustainable energy development.
Increased Home Value
Another often overlooked benefit of solar panels is their impact on property value. Studies have shown that homes with solar energy systems sell at higher prices than comparable homes without them. Potential buyers view solar panels as a valuable long-term investment because they lower energy costs and demonstrate a commitment to sustainability. For homeowners considering selling in the future, solar panels can make a property more attractive and marketable.

Technological Advancements
Modern solar panels are more efficient and durable than ever before. Advances in technology have increased energy output while reducing maintenance requirements. Many systems are designed to last 25 years or more, making them a long-term solution for energy independence. Homeowners can also pair solar panels with battery storage systems to store excess energy for use during peak hours or outages, further enhancing their energy security.
